/** Unit tests for AvroRpc. */
public class TestAvroRpc extends TestCase {
private static final String ADDRESS = "0.0.0.0";
public static final Log LOG =
LogFactory.getLog(TestAvroRpc.class);
private static Configuration conf = new Configuration();
int datasize = 1024*100;
int numThreads = 50;
public TestAvroRpc(String name) { super(name); }
public static class TestImpl implements AvroTestProtocol {
public void ping() {}
public Utf8 echo(Utf8 value) { return value; }
public int add(int v1, int v2) { return v1 + v2; }
public int error() throws Problem {
throw new Problem();
}
}
public void testCalls() throws Exception {
Configuration conf = new Configuration();
Server server = AvroRpc.getServer(new TestImpl(), ADDRESS, 0, conf);
AvroTestProtocol proxy = null;
try {
server.start();
InetSocketAddress addr = NetUtils.getConnectAddress(server);
proxy =
(AvroTestProtocol)AvroRpc.getProxy(AvroTestProtocol.class, addr, conf);
proxy.ping();
Utf8 utf8Result = proxy.echo(new Utf8("hello world"));
assertEquals(new Utf8("hello world"), utf8Result);
int intResult = proxy.add(1, 2);
assertEquals(3, intResult);
boolean caught = false;
try {
proxy.error();
} catch (AvroRemoteException e) {
LOG.debug("Caught " + e);
caught = true;
}
assertTrue(caught);
} finally {
server.stop();
}
}
}
